Oscar D. Runyan Died June 26th at Des Moines
Oscar D. Runyan, 79, former resident of Colfax, died Friday, June 26th at the Des Moines General Hospital after a three week illness.
Mr. Runyan had resided at Bondurant since 1938 and operated the Bondurant hardware store with his son, Ray. He was mayor of Bondurant during World War II and later operated Oscar’s Gun and Fix It Shop. He was a member of the Altoona Masonic Lodge No. 407.
Mr. Runyan was born at Mason City, Neb., moved to Colfax and then to Newton where he was employed at the Maytag Company for 18 years. He served as night policeman while residing at Colfax.
Survivors include his wife, Jennie; three sons, Ralph, of Tipton, Ray of Bondurant and Ivan of Ames; three daughters, Mrs. Francis Crawford, Mrs. Hubert Butler and Mrs. Harvey Lewis, all of Bondurant; a sister, Mrs. Lydia Hodgson of Des Moines; a brother, Gilbert, of Grand Rapids, Mich., 20 grandchildren, and 13 great grandchildren.
Funeral services were held at 2 p.m. Monday at the Bondurant Christian church. Burial was in the Bondurant Cemetery.
Source: Colfax Tribune; Thursday, July 2, 1964
